**Vendor note: Inkmill markdown pipeline**

Rendering for Parchway docs is outsourced to Inkmill under an annual contract, renewing each March. They handle sanitization and PDF export; we own the upload queue. SLA: 4-hour response on rendering failures. Escalate only after two failed retries. Their support desk is reachable at the address below.

billing contact of hahaf-baguf = zorael.tammir.jorius@sivrelhq.internal

Onboarding: Crashfall Pipeline Basics

Crashfall is the pipeline that ingests crash reports from the Willowby mobile app and routes them to support queues. New support staff should learn the triage dashboard first; raw report access comes later. Raw reports are encrypted at rest, and the decryption tool will ask you once per session for the team recovery passphrase, which is:

strongbox words: sildor-gorael-noveth-zorok-jormir-julok-juldor-praius-istiel-lamix-gilix-silion-drueth-druius

HANDOVER — Commission Scheme Revision

To the incoming director: the revised scheme goes live on the 1st. Key changes: accelerators start at 110% of quota, not 100%; multi-year Quillstone deals pay out over term, not upfront; clawbacks extend to nine months. Reps were briefed last week — expect pushback from the Ashgrove pod. Payroll mapping is done; Tomas owns the calculator. Disputes route through RevOps, not you. One outstanding item: the enterprise override rate is unresolved. Background for that decision sits below.

internal memo for kahif-kawig: Project Fravan slips by two quarters because of the tooling delay.